BSAC Branches usually conduct diver training over a number of weeks at weekly training sessions. Training is conducted by qualified instructors and all necessary equipment is supplied by the Branch.

Before deciding to take up Diving, prospective new members may wish to enroll in a "Try Dive" session. This involves a pool session and information on the benefits of being a BSAC club member

 

Benefits of BSAC/Luton SAC Membership

Once the initial paperwork, fitness to dive certification and first annual subscription payment are complete, training can begin.

An Ocean Diver Student Pack will be ordered per student. Dates to commence Theory classes and sheltered water training will also be advised.

Minimum Age

Scuba training is available to anyone aged 14 and over, and who is medically fit. Parental approval is needed for anyone under the age of 18.

The Training Process

BSAC branches conduct diver training over several weekly training sessions. Training will take place in some or all of the following formats:
: Sheltered Water (Bath Road Pool)
: Classroom (Theory)
: Open Water (Stoney Cove and/or coastal location)

The training is conducted by qualified instructors.

Luton BSAC has many items of diving equipment which, where appropriate, is for use by trainee divers who are club members.

It is club policy to encourage new divers to buy their own diving equipment as they near completion of sheltered water training and are planning to commence the Open Water training and dives to qualify as an Ocean Diver.

A small charge is made to club members who require the use of club equipment at Stoney Cove.

 

Skill Development Courses (SDC's)

Skill Development Courses (SDC's) normally cover more advanced Diving subjects encountered from Dive Leader training upwards. However, some SDCs can be taken at Ocean and Sports Diver grade.

SDC's are arranged within the BSAC Eastern Region.

Information on SDC's can be found on the BSAC HQ website www.BSAC-Eastern.org.uk or in Dive Magazine.

 

If you intend to enroll on a SDC, the club recommends that you make the Training Officer aware.

There maybe others within the branch who would like to attend the SDC.

In addition, the following SDC's can be run within the club

:Practical Rescue Management
:Oxygen Administration
:Search and Recovery
:Life Saver
:Advanced Lifesaver
:Compressor Operation

 

Luton BSAC welcomes membership inquiries from divers who have qualifications from agencies other than BSAC, e.g. PADI, SAA, DAN, CMAS
Subject to assessing current diver qualifications and experience, a cross-over can be made to the equivalent BSAC diver grade. Contact the club training officer for further details.
